Building District Capacity for Environmental Literacy and MWEEs in Delaware

This project strengthens state and school district capacity to integrate environmental literacy (E-LIT) and Meaningful Watershed Educational Experiences (MWEEs) into learning for Delaware students. Collaborators will create a Delaware MWEE Facilitator Guide and work directly with Caesar Rodney and Appoquinimink school districts and Sussex Montessori Charter School in Delaware to expand environmental education and develop E-LIT plans that serve as models for other districts.

Funded by: Del. Sea Grant and NOAA

Project Lead: David Christopher (Del. Sea Grant)
